Lando Norris Slams Max Verstappen’s Racing Tactics in Fierce Showdown
In a fierce showdown on the Formula 1 tracks, Lando Norris has taken a stand against Max Verstappen’s aggressive racing tactics. The two drivers clashed multiple times last year, culminating in a dramatic incident in Austria that saw Verstappen failing to finish the race.
Despite the intense rivalry between them, Norris emphasized that he still holds respect for Verstappen as a competitor. “I don’t think he’s done anything untoward towards me,” Norris stated. “He’s raced against me very, very toughly, as he has the right to do. He’s made my life very, very tough at times.”
Norris, who is currently battling it out with his teammate Oscar Piastri in the ongoing championship, acknowledged Verstappen’s achievements in the sport, including his four world championships. However, the McLaren driver made it clear that he will not back down in future encounters on the track.
“I race in the aggressive way I believe is correct, and he does the same,” Norris explained. “The stewards are the ones who decide what is right and wrong.”
